Storage that stays in shape after daily use
Modular storage takes regular handling. Drawers open and shut many times a day. Doors are pulled and pushed from all angles. Ordinary boards often swell or crack. PVC boards hold shape better. They do not change with moisture. They do not expand with heat. That is what makes them ideal for kitchens, bathrooms and laundry areas.

Lightweight boards make fitting faster
When working on modular wardrobes or lofts, the carpenter needs material that is easy to lift and fix. Solid wood becomes too heavy. Some panels need multiple people just to move. PVC boards are lighter. One person can carry and place them easily. That reduces labour time. It also helps keep fittings accurate.
Light boards also put less pressure on the hinges and runners. This helps drawers last longer. That brings more value to the entire unit.
No paint or polish needed on surface
PVC boards come in pre-finished colours. Some are plain. Some carry wooden texture. That means they do not need polish. This reduces time spent on the job. It also keeps the home clean during fitting. You can use them directly on shutters or open racks.
For those who want a plain white or beige inside the wardrobe, PVC boards are the simplest option. The colour stays even without touch-up.
Handles moisture better than many other boards
Storage spaces often face moisture. Steam from hot food. Damp clothes in utility areas. Drops near the sink. Most plywood or particle boards begin to swell with repeated exposure. PVC boards do not absorb water the same way. They stay flat. They do not warp.

Hollow structure supports easy wiring
Smart cabinets now carry lighting. Some also hold charging points or hidden gadgets. These fittings need room for wiring. Solid boards need drilling. That takes time. PVC boards support concealed wiring because of their hollow design. The wire can run inside without cutting the outer surface.
This helps create clean storage units with smart features. The board supports the tech without losing its strength.
Easy to clean and maintain
PVC boards carry a smooth surface. Dust does not stick. Oil marks can be wiped with water. That makes them perfect for kitchen cabinets and bathroom vanities. There is no need for special cleaning liquids. A cloth and water will do.
This low effort makes it easy for families who do not want high-maintenance furniture. It also helps in rented homes where regular touch-ups are not done.
Helps reduce termite-related issues
Wood attracts termites. Particle boards often carry hidden risk. PVC boards do not. Their plastic base keeps pests away. That makes them ideal for homes in areas with high termite problems. Many people now use PVC boards for lofts and utility storage to avoid future damage.
